Address Unknown: Fukushima Now
Arif Khan
Address Unknown: Fukushima Now is an immersive VR documentary that takes audiences to the heart of Fukushima to meet survivors living in the shadow of the crisis today. Using volumetric capture and photogrammetry technology, the documentary transports viewers into an experience that explores the disaster and its lasting impact on communities and the environment. It reveals how a community endures in the aftermath of trauma and recalls memories of homes they can no longer return to. Through local voices, the experience also examines the meaning of home and how it may be redefined in the face of disaster.
